OPTION YEAR TWO, MINI-BOS 29 PALMS CA is a federal award for Navfac Southwest held by Logistics & Technology Services, Inc. Estimated value $3.8M ($291K obligated). Current period of performance ends Sep 30, 2022 (potential Mar 25, 2023). Last award drew 4 bidders. Place of performance: TWENTYNINE PALMS CA. Related solicitation N6247318R5003.
